A189322 Number of nondecreasing arrangements of n+2 numbers in 0..5 with the last equal to 5 and each after the second equal to the sum of one or two of the preceding four.
8, 12, 21, 33, 54, 84, 119, 157, 195, 233, 271, 309, 347, 385, 423, 461, 499, 537, 575, 613, 651, 689, 727, 765, 803, 841, 879, 917, 955, 993, 1031, 1069, 1107, 1145, 1183, 1221, 1259, 1297, 1335, 1373, 1411, 1449, 1487, 1525, 1563, 1601, 1639, 1677, 1715
Offset: 1

Formula
Empirical: a(n) = 38*n - 147 for n>6.
Empirical g.f.: x*(8 - 4*x + 5*x^2 + 3*x^3 + 9*x^4 + 9*x^5 + 5*x^6 + 3*x^7) / (1 - x)^2. - Colin Barker, May 02 2018
